Adobe Reader DC is a popular PDF reader, and it has the ability to digitally sign documents. In this blog post, we will discuss how to digitally sign a PDF with Adobe Reader DC. They are used to verify the authenticity of documents, and to ensure that the contents of the document have not been altered. Digital signatures are becoming increasingly important in the modern world. ![]()
